Nikola corporation reports fourth quarter and full year 2022 results
Reported gaap net loss per share of $0.46 and non-gaap net loss per share of $0.37 for q4 2022 advancing deployment of zero-emissions trucks in fleets through innovative integrated mobility solutions entered into partnership with chargepoint allowing nikola and our dealers to resell chargepoint products unveiled the first hyla hydrogen mobile fueler, providing flexible, capital-efficient fueling infrastructure on track to be first to market and commercialize fuel cell electric vehicles (fcevs) with deliveries expected in q4 2023 received tre fcev orders for up to 75 from plug power and 15 from biagi brothers continued to execute on and build our energy business with partners furthered development on phoenix hydrogen hub, invitation to phase ii department of energy (doe) loan process, final investment decision expected q3 2023 strategic partnership with plug power for nationwide hydrogen supply of up to 125 metric-tons per day expected collaboration with fortescue future industries (ffi) for green hydrogen projects across the country phoenix , feb. 23, 2023 /prnewswire/ -- nikola corporation (nasdaq: nkla), a global leader in zero-emissions transportation solutions, today reported financial results for the quarter and full-year ended december 31, 2022. "during the fourth quarter we strengthened our commercial and sales operations, which is expected to lead to increased sales and accelerated customer deliveries," said nikola ceo, michael lohscheller.
